LOS ANGELES (Aug. 13)—The CALIFORNIA ASSOCIATION OF REALTORS® today
announced the appointment of real estate technology entrepreneur Scott
Kucirek to lead the development and implementation of a groundbreaking
initiative, CALMLS, which encompasses a statewide MLS as well as a property
information service.
Kucirek will be responsible for the operational strategy, vendor selection
process, implementation of the strategic vision and other top-level
managerial functions associated with CALMLS.

Kucirek's background combines pertinent experience in technology innovation
and implementation, as well as executive management at two major realty
companies with operations in multiple states. Most recently, Kucirek was
general manager of Prudential California, Nevada and Texas Realty, one of
the country's largest brokerage companies. In this position, he was
responsible for strategic implementation and day-to-day operations of 47
realty offices with 2,100 real estate agents in Northern California and
Nevada. During Kucirek's two-year stint at the helm, these offices closed
approximately $8 billion worth of real estate sales and generated roughly
$60 million in revenue.
Previously, Kucirek was president and EVP of new market development at
ZipRealty, an innovative technology-oriented real estate brokerage company.
Kucirek co-founded the Emeryville, Calif.-based company in 1999.

Kucirek will work with the CALMLS Board and senior C.A.R. staff. The board
is comprised of 17 California REALTORS®, who represent different geographic
regions, diverse brokerage firms and realty practice areas throughout the
state. CALMLS intends to enable REALTORS® to access MLS and property data
throughout the entire state. The entity will announce its rollout schedule
and technology offerings over the next several weeks.
Sixty-six local REALTOR® associations and three regional MLSs representing
more than 120,000 members across the state have already signed non-binding
letters of intent to participate in CALMLS.
